function checkEmailAddress(field) 
{
	var goodEmail = field.value.match(/\b(^(\S+@).+((\.com)|(\.net)|(\.edu)|(\.mil)|(\.gov)|(\.org)|(\..{2,2}))$)\b/gi);
	if (goodEmail)
	{
	  return true;
	} 
	else 
	{
	   alert('Please enter a valid e-mail address.')
	   return false;
	}
}
function checkForm(){
   var nmcheck = document.getElementById("customername");
   var emcheck = document.getElementById("customeremail");
   var pcheck = document.getElementById("productname");
   var qcheck = document.getElementById("productquestion");
   if (nmcheck.value == "") 
   {
      alert("Please enter your name.");
      return false;
   }   
   if (emcheck.value == "") 
   {
		alert("Please enter an e-mail address");
		return false;
   }
   if (pcheck.value == "")
   {
		alert("Please enter your product name");
		return false;
   }
   if (qcheck.value == "")
   {
		alert("Please enter your question");
		return false;
   }
   if (!checkEmailAddress(emcheck))
		return false;
	
	return true;
}
